Replacement Keys

A lot of cars today have a key fob that lets you open your car's doors and start the engine at the touch of one button. The keys have a microchip in them that is programmed to the specific car's system so it can detect and communicate with the vehicle. This allows the car to determine that it is the correct key and that the driver has authority to use it. If your key is lost, you may be required to pay a substantial amount to get an replacement from the dealer. You can also get an aftermarket chip made by a third-party firm. These keys are cheaper than the keys from the dealer and can be purchased on the internet.

When you need to replace a key, you will need your vehicle identification number (VIN). The VIN is found on the driver's side door post or a metal plate on the dashboard for the driver. It is also crucial to have your registration number as well as insurance information.

Transponder Keys

The most common car keys these days are outfitted with a transponder chips, meaning that it communicates with the vehicle via radio frequency. This is a safer and more secure alternative to non-transponder keys, which don't have this feature and can be easily duplicated.

A transponder, or miniature electronic key, is a coded chip (actually a set of windings, similar to those in an electric motor). When you insert your original transponder keys into the ignition and turn it, the engine control unit will transmit a signal to the chip. The chip transmits a code to the immobilizer system in the car, which disables it.

Transponder chips are a standard feature on many modern cars and are designed to ward off car thefts, specifically by amateur or old-school thieves who often use brute strength and the "hot wire" method. It's important to remember that nothing is foolproof, and criminals are constantly developing methods to defeat this technology.

The cost of replacing a transponder can depend on the year, model and year of manufacture. It may be a little more expensive than the standard metal key, but it's well worth it for the extra security this technology provides. Generally, you can get a transponder key cut at most locksmiths and some local shops like AutoZone or Walmart.

A dead battery is the most frequent cause of a remote key fob not working properly in the Octavia. It is easy to fix. Fold out the key fob, and then utilize your thumb or flat screwdriver to remove the cover near the arrows. Remove the old battery and insert a brand new battery inside with the positive side facing upwards. Replace the cover and turn the fob.
